A Crossover Pilot Study of the Effect of Amiloride on Proteinuria

Summary

This cross-over study is designed to test the hypothesis that amiloride will reduce urinary protein excretion and protect the kidney from rapid progression in proteinuric kidney disease.

Conditions

  • Proteinuria

Interventions

DRUG

Amiloride

5mg twice a day for 8 weeks

DRUG

Triamterene

50mg twice a day for 8 weeks
